OpenAI is partnering with major global security companies to expand the rollout of 'GPT-5.6 Cyber,' an artificial intelligence (AI) model specialized in cybersecurity. The goal is to provide customized security AI to organizations and professionals engaged in defense operations.

On the 11th, OpenAI announced the expansion of the 'Daybreak Cyber Partner' program with leading global security firms, including Accenture, Cisco, Cloudflare, CrowdStrike, IBM, and Palo Alto Networks Unit 42. Through this partnership, each company can integrate OpenAI's advanced cybersecurity models into their own security products, managed security services (MSS), and customer projects. Customers who have completed Amazon Bedrock registration can also access OpenAI's Daybreak Blue and Red services.

'GPT-5.6 Cyber' and Customized 'Daybreak' Unveiled

The newly introduced 'GPT-5.6 Cyber' is an AI model specialized for advanced vulnerability research, exploit verification, and security testing. In conjunction with the model's release, OpenAI also unveiled the 'Daybreak' program, which provides customized security AI to individuals and organizations conducting authorized defense operations.

Daybreak is divided into two categories based on intended use, and only pre-approved users can access them.

  • Daybreak Blue: Designed for general defense missions, based on 'GPT-5.6 Sol.' OpenAI recommended that most security teams use this module as a starting point.
  • Daybreak Red: Directly provides 'GPT-5.6 Cyber' to organizations requiring professional security capabilities, such as advanced vulnerability detection, exploit development, and red team penetration testing.

Both environments are subject to strict multi-layered security controls, including identity verification, account security, real-time monitoring, restrictions on use beyond approved purposes, and legal compliance verification.

Top-Tier Benchmark Performance and Real-World Vulnerability Discoveries

'GPT-5.6 Cyber' recorded the highest success rate in the 'ExploitGym' benchmark among all models evaluated by OpenAI. This benchmark assesses the ability to convert known vulnerabilities into code that can be used in actual attacks. Additionally, it demonstrated outstanding performance by successfully completing 95% of all requests in an evaluation of high-difficulty cybersecurity task execution rates.

Remarkable results were also achieved in real-world software vulnerability research. During the analysis of Google Chrome's JavaScript engine 'V8,' OpenAI researchers discovered two previously unreported vulnerabilities that could be chained together for exploitation and reported them to Google, which promptly applied security patches for the vulnerabilities.

Furthermore, in a recent cyber evaluation, 'GPT-5.6 Sol' and a research model accessed the actual Hugging Face system and discovered new vulnerabilities. They also secured attack paths enabling privilege escalation and remote code execution, confirming that AI's offensive capabilities are rapidly evolving.

'Defender's Advantage' Principle and Emphasis on Industry Collaboration

OpenAI stated that as AI's offensive capabilities become more sophisticated, the same technology must be proactively supplied to defenders. Accordingly, the company adopted a dual-track approach: providing 'GPT-5.6 Sol' with safety guardrails for general defense operations, and providing 'GPT-5.6 Cyber' for advanced exploit development only after a separate review process.

Clem Delangue, Co-Founder and CEO of Hugging Face, emphasized that "AI safety cannot be solved by one company developing it behind closed doors; security professionals worldwide must broadly leverage AI and collaborate."
